DRAPER v. COMMISSIONER OF SOCIAL SEC.

Case No. 3:11CV2287.

980 F.Supp.2d 841 (2013)

Patrice DRAPER, etc., Plaintiff v. COMMISSIONER OF SOCIAL SECURITY, Defendant.

United States District Court, N.D. Ohio, Western Division.

March 15, 2013.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Kirk B. Roose , Roose & Ressler, Lorain, OH, for Plaintiff.

Kathleen L. Midian , Assistant United States Attorney, United States Courthouse, Cleveland, OH, for Defendant.


ORDER

JAMES G. CARR, Senior District Judge.

This is a social security disability case in which the Magistrate Judge recommended, and I approved, remand on behalf of a nine-year-old girl afflicted with multiple impairments. (Doc. 17). Pending is plaintiff's application for an award of fees under the Equal Access to Justice Act (EAJA), 28 U.S.C. § 2412. (Doc. 21).
